About 3 Tyddyn Ucha Cottages
3 Tyddyn Ucha Cottages is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Llangernyw, Abergele, Abergele (LL22 8PS). It has a recorded floor area of 154 m² (around 1655 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(April 2010)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 71).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from April 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include notable views.
Today's modelled estimate of £331,000 sits 54% above the 2015 sale of £215,000. 4 planning records sit against the property, 4 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, a porch and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in March 2015, so it's been off the market for around 11 years.
